It's worth measuring your space before shopping for a wall-mounted electric fireplace. Making use of masking tape to create a mock-up on the wall can help you visualize the space it will take and ensure that you've picked the correct size. Be sure to be aware of any clearances required. Some models require a specific distance between the fireboxes and combustible material such as drywall.

Installation

There are two major kinds of electric fireplaces you can pick for a media wall with an electric fire in the center. Inset (or hole-in-the-wall) fires like the Evonic Creative Electric Fire recessed into the wall for an elegant appearance, or free-standing electric fireplaces that can be positioned against the wall.

The choice is based on your room's size and your personal preferences. Both have advantages, but each has its own unique style.

If you want a modern, clean design for your media wall An inset electric fireplace is the best option. They are flush with the wall for a smooth finish and don't have any protruding parts, making them easy to maintain.
